James Brown; Ship’s name: HMS Wildboar; Pay book number: SB 3; Rank: Cook; Relation: Wife Maria; When Allotted: 1808; Remarks: Discharged invalided (date not given).
John Palmer; Ship’s name: HMS Wildboar; Pay book number: SB 10; Rank: Boatswain; Relation: Wife Mary; When Allotted: 1808; Remarks: Discharged invalided (date not given).
Charles Tucker; Ship’s name: HMS Wildboar; Pay book number: SB 11; Rank: Carpenter; Relation: Wife Mary; When Allotted: 1808; Remarks: Blank.
William Rowe; Ship’s name: HMS Wildboar; Pay book number: ML 4; Rank: Sergeant Royal Marine; Relation: Wife Sarah; When Allotted: 1808; Remarks: Blank.
Thomas Monaghan; Ship’s name: HMS Wildboar; Pay book number: SB 51; Rank: Able Seaman; Relation: Wife (name not given); When Allotted: 1808; Remarks: Discharged to HMS Caesar (date not given).
John Denham; Ship’s name: HMS Wildboar; Pay book number: SB 86; Rank: Quartergunner; Relation: Wife (name not given); When Allotted: 1809; Remarks: Discharged 16 February 1810 to HMS Salvador.
Patrick Bryan; Ship’s name: HMS Surly; Pay book number: SB 148; Rank: Ordinary Seaman; Relation: Wife Mary; When Allotted: 1814; Remarks: Deserted 9 June 1814.
B Stanburgh; Ship’s name: HMS Surly; Pay book number: SB 175; Rank: Landsman; Relation: Mother Sarah; When Allotted: 1814; Remarks: Deserted (date not given).
Phillip Millman; Ship’s name: HMS Surly; Pay book number: SB 57; Rank: Quartermaster; Relation: Wife Elizabeth; When Allotted: 1814; Remarks: Blank.
Stephen Diamond; Ship’s name: HMS Surly; Pay book number: SB 156; Rank: Able Seaman; Relation: Mother Elizabeth Trollop; When Allotted: 1814; Remarks: Blank.
Joseph Lamb; Ship’s name: HMS Surly; Pay book number: SB 167; Rank: Able Seaman; Relation: Mother Frances; When Allotted: 1814; Remarks: Blank.
